Eteindre pc quand il rentre dans réseau Wifi
Fermé
le-poisson-rouge
Messages postés
8
Date d'inscription
mercredi 4 mars 2009
Statut
Membre
Dernière intervention
13 avril 2010
-
13 avril 2010 à 11:06
-Arod- - 13 avril 2010 à 14:27
-Arod- - 13 avril 2010 à 14:27
A voir également:
- Eteindre pc quand il rentre dans réseau Wifi
- Benchmark pc - Guide
- Ecran noir pc - Guide
- Reinitialiser pc - Guide
- Pc lent - Guide
- Wifi pc - Guide
2 réponses
Salut, pour que ta solution marche, il faudrait que les pc se connectent automatiquement à l'ap wifi du batiment.
Donc pour ca il faut le configurer manuellement sur les pc.
Tant qu'à faire, autant leur configurer une adresse IP.
Puis tout ce qu'il te reste à faire, c'est écrire un script que tu fais tourner constamment sur un serveur (c'est une démarche relativement lourde) qui ping constament les IP que tu a configuré et dés qu'il y a un retour au ping, tu shutdown l'adresse IP qui a répondu.
Bref je pense qu'une solution utilisant un sniffer pour détecter les connexions serait bien plus efficace.
Donc pour ca il faut le configurer manuellement sur les pc.
Tant qu'à faire, autant leur configurer une adresse IP.
Puis tout ce qu'il te reste à faire, c'est écrire un script que tu fais tourner constamment sur un serveur (c'est une démarche relativement lourde) qui ping constament les IP que tu a configuré et dés qu'il y a un retour au ping, tu shutdown l'adresse IP qui a répondu.
Bref je pense qu'une solution utilisant un sniffer pour détecter les connexions serait bien plus efficace.
Bon je te fais un ptit algo vite fait:
variable a = vrai
tant que a = vrai faire
| faire
|| ping ipclasseA
|| si réponse =! délais d'attente de la demande dépassé alors
||| shutdown ipclasseA
|| Finsi
| Tant qu'il me reste des IP à ping
fintantque
[Edit] Comme c'est incompréhensible sans l'incrémentation, j'ai mis une | pour chaque tabulation.
variable a = vrai
tant que a = vrai faire
| faire
|| ping ipclasseA
|| si réponse =! délais d'attente de la demande dépassé alors
||| shutdown ipclasseA
|| Finsi
| Tant qu'il me reste des IP à ping
fintantque
[Edit] Comme c'est incompréhensible sans l'incrémentation, j'ai mis une | pour chaque tabulation.
le-poisson-rouge
Messages postés
8
Date d'inscription
mercredi 4 mars 2009
Statut
Membre
Dernière intervention
13 avril 2010
4
13 avril 2010 à 12:27
13 avril 2010 à 12:27
Merci pour l'algo, sa m'éclaircit un peu plus !
Par contre, ce serais mieux de stocker les adresses ip dans un fichier à part, non ...?
Et pour le test de ping, serait il possible de faire un ping 10.8.7.x >c:\ip.txt
et de tester le contenu de ip.txt pour voir si le ping répond ...?
Une autre question, quand ce script sera au point, j'aurais pensé à utiliser les taches automatisées (WSI) pour le lancer, c'est une bonne idée ?
Merci d'avance.
Par contre, ce serais mieux de stocker les adresses ip dans un fichier à part, non ...?
Et pour le test de ping, serait il possible de faire un ping 10.8.7.x >c:\ip.txt
et de tester le contenu de ip.txt pour voir si le ping répond ...?
Une autre question, quand ce script sera au point, j'aurais pensé à utiliser les taches automatisées (WSI) pour le lancer, c'est une bonne idée ?
Merci d'avance.
13 avril 2010 à 11:31
Les PCs portables ont tous une adresse fixe (de classe A).
J'ai aussi pensé à configurer les réseaux wifis préférés sur ceux ci pour qu'ils se connectent automatiquement à la borne du batiment "interdit".
Oui effectivement il y aura un serveur qui s'occupera de cette borne.
Pour le script par contre, je n'ais aucune idée de son contenu, la programmation ce n'est pas tellement mon point fort !!! Pourrait tu m'éclairer un peu plus ... ?